Syntheses and Electrical Properties of α,α,α′,α′-Tetracyanodiphenoquinodimethane Complexes

Abstract
Two charge-transfer complexes of α,α,α′,α′-tetracyanodiphenoquinodimethane (TCNDQ), i.e., N-methylphenazinium (NMP)–TCNDQ, and N-methylquinolinium (NMQ)–TCNDQ, were synthesized. The electrical resistivities with pressed pellet samples were 7.1×108 Ω cm for NMP+TCNDQ− and 6.9×107 Ω cm for NMQ+TCNDQ−; they are thus much less conductive than the corresponding TCNQ, complexes.
